Princess Diana expressed her desire for her sons, William and Harry, to engage in more meaningful communication. This sentiment was conveyed in a two-page letter she wrote in November 1995 to a supporter named Michael Barrett following the BBC Panorama interview.

In the heartfelt letter, Diana expressed gratitude for Barrett’s supportive words and emphasized the importance of deep communication with her sons, William and Harry. She concluded the letter with thanks and signed it as “Yours sincerely, Diana.”

The letter, which is set to be auctioned by Reeman Dansies ‘Royalty, Antiques & Fine Art,” is expected to fetch between £3,000 and £4,000. Diana tragically passed away in a car accident in Paris in August 1997 at the age of 36.

Scheduled for auction on June 9, this significant handwritten letter by H.R.H. Diana, Princess of Wales, discusses her Panorama interview and reflects on moving forward in life. Diana appreciated Barrett’s supportive letter and looked forward to teaching her sons the importance of deep communication.

Barrett, deeply moved by Diana’s response to his letter, had shared his thoughts on the challenges of moving on and finding hope, prompting Diana’s heartfelt reply. In 2024, a release of emails shed light on the scandal surrounding Martin Bashir’s Panorama interview with Diana. Bashir, accused of deceiving Diana and her brother Charles Spencer to secure the interview, departed from the BBC in May 2021 due to health reasons.

The same year, an investigation found Bashir guilty of dishonesty and breaching BBC editorial standards.
